The Company/ Organization
Our client is basically a bank/ a financial institute., They finance development projects in 70 countries, founded in 1948 and their goal is to support partner countries in fighting poverty and accelerating sustainable economic development, maintaining peace, and protecting both the environment and the climate.
In Ghana, they have been a long-standing development partner to the Government of Ghana, engaged in the priority areas, amongst others Technical and Vocational Education and Training (TVET), Financial Sector Development, and Energy.

Our well-established portfolio with Ghana focuses on the support of the development of a modern vocational training system. An economy cannot develop sustainably and on a large scale without a qualified non-academic workforce. In vocational training in particular, the training and teaching curricula are still poorly aligned with the actual needs of companies, and teaching infrastructure is inadequate.
